APAR status
Closed as program error.
Error description
Users use the APL xx function to colorize their sources. It used to work in their PCOMM v6.0.10. After moving to PCOMM 14.0.1 level, if they customize the keyboard and enter the string "APL xx" function on a certain key command, they are getting an error validation message when saving the changes: "PCSKBD160 - Unrecognized key-action: APL xx"
Local fix
Problem summary
**************************************************************** * USERS AFFECTED: * * All IBM Personal Communications users * **************************************************************** * PROBLEM DESCRIPTION: * * Unable to save the APL xx functions on the keyboard. User * * sees validation error message PCSKBD160 * **************************************************************** * RECOMMENDATION: * **************************************************************** PCOMM APL xx is not supporting the lower hexadecimal value from 0x00 to 0x40 in the following PCOMM version 6.0.19, 12.0, 13.0 and 14.0. The older PCOMM versions were supporting lower hexadecimal values. In this case PCOMM is providing the setting to enable lower hexadecimal value for APL xx function using PCSWIN.INI file. [Edit] AllowAPL=N, Default, current behaviour (dis-allow APL characters below 0x40) [Edit] AllowAPL=Y, To dis-allow APL charecters below 0x20 (allow APL characters from 0x20 to 0x40)
Problem conclusion
PCSKBD.DLL code changes made to support the lower hexadecimal (0x20 to 0x40) in APL xx keyboard functions. AllowAPL keyword enabled in PCSWIN.INI file
Temporary fix
Comments
APAR Information
APAR number
IT35902
Reported component name
PCOMM COMBO-ENG
Reported component ID
5639I7000
Reported release
E00
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t / Xsystem
Submitted date
2021-02-15
Closed date
2021-04-13
Last modified date
2021-04-13
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Modules/Macros
PCSKBD
Fix information
Fixed component name
PCOMM COMBO-ENG
Fixed component ID
5639I7000
Applicable component levels
[{"Line of Business":{"code":"LOB35","label":"Mainframe SW"},"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SSEQ5Y","label":"Personal Communications"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"E00"}]
Document Information
Modified date:
14 April 2021